I would like to kindly request your assistance in developing (or confirming the possibility of creating) a custom widget with the following general features:
Placement and Design
A floating icon that can be placed in the top-right corner of the website, or any other desired location on the site.
The icon should be customizable (e.g., a default exclamation mark “!”), with the option to change it to a different symbol if needed.
When users hover over or click the icon, a floating panel or modal should appear, revealing various interactive options.
Desired Features
This widget would serve as a centralized place for visitors to interact with the website developer and access helpful site-related information. The ideal features include:
Displaying the name, logo, or short description of the site developer.
A quick way to contact the developer (via email, WhatsApp, or other channels).
An option to report issues or bugs found on the website.
A section to send feedback or suggestions.
A comment section where users can:
Write freely
Attach images
Take or upload screenshots of the site
All submitted messages should be automatically sent to an email address configured by the site owner.
Display the current version of the website.
Show the date of the last update.
Present important notices, such as:
Scheduled maintenance
Known technical issues
Legal updates or cookie usage notices
Optionally display a brief changelog or update history.
(Optional) Let users submit a quick rating (e.g., 1–5 stars).
(Optional) Provide a download link to the developer’s digital card or portfolio.
Modular Flexibility
All of the above features should ideally be modular, meaning the site admin can enable or disable each feature as needed.
I would sincerely appreciate your guidance on whether this widget can be created using Elfsight’s tools, or if you offer a similar widget that can be adapted to meet these requirements.
Many thanks for such a detailed description of your idea!
Given the wide range of features required, I am afraid, it would be hard to combine them all in one widget.
However, you can use several different widgets to implement a specific range of functionalities.
This can be done with our All-in-One Chat app. Here you can:
Upload a custom bubble icon
Change bubble position
Add the needed contacts like WhatsApp, Email, phone number etc
Add company name and logo
This should be done with our Comments widget, which we’re currently working on. Please upvote this idea to receive a notification once it’s released.
And for this case, you’ll need something like a Status page widget. Please upvote this idea if you’d like it to be released
As a workaround, you can use our Banner widget to showcase the info about scheduled maintenance, technical issues, etc.
Please let me know if this explains things or if you have any questions left.
You’re right — after thinking it through, I realized I got a bit carried away with the original idea.
To clarify, what I actually need is much simpler:
Final Widget Idea:
A small floating icon (preferably a customizable “exclamation mark (!)” that can be placed in the “top-right corner” or a"nywhere on the site".
When clicked, it should open a very simple panel or form where the user can:
Write a quick comment (to report a bug or give feedback)
(Optional but ideal) Attach or take a screenshot of the current page
The submitted message should be automatically sent to a configured email address.
That’s all I really need.
It’s a small but powerful tool for anyone managing multiple websites, as it allows direct and contextual feedback from users.
If any of your existing widgets can be adapted to do this, I’d love to know which one you’d recommend.